In respect of earmarked funds, the Extended Public Works Programme (EPWP) Incentive to Provinces showed an expenditure of R129 million or 27 per cent, with EPWP Incentives to municipalities at R255 million or 44 per cent, and the Construction Education Training Authority (CETA) [Human Resources], Energy Efficiency, Compensation of Losses, Distress Relief, and Loskop Settlement all stood at 0 per cent by 31 December 2010. The DoPW attributed the slow expenditure on Energy Efficiency to the protracted bidding process which resulted in the late awarding of the bid and the lack of capacity to manage the project.
